Over 3,000 finished sq ft of living space! Three finished levels, an open concept, numerous updates and a stunning one acre setting at Lincoln Park. Located at the North side of US 30, this ideal location is conveniently close to schools, major retailers and employers. Make this spacious home, yours and enjoy days relaxing in the hot tub, enjoying the oversized backyard, private patios, fire pit area or the fantastic in-ground pool area and bar. As you enter the front door, you'll fall in love with the beautiful laminate flooring that leads you to the front living room. An open concept awaits you with white cabinetry, stainless appliances, island with breakfast bar and adjacent dining area. Which opens to the family room with fireplace and access to the private backyard patio and entertaining areas. The second level hosts the primary suite with double sink vanity and tile walk in shower. As well as additional bedrooms and full bath. At the lower level, you have space to create a rec room or home theatre area. With a bonus guest room and full bath!
